The social safety net during economic transition : the case of Poland (English)

The economic transformation process, by its very nature, creates forces which require a major reshaping of the social safety net: (a) it creates new problems, notably unemployment and poverty, which require an expansion of the existing system of income transfers; (b) it leads to a short-run decline in output, and hence to a period of fiscal stringency, stressing the need for cost savings; and (c) it widens the distribution of earnings.
